无金属、低成本的g-C3 N4作为解决环境和能源问题的光催化剂受到了研究人员的广泛关注。然而,体相g-C3 N4光吸收有限,反应活性中心少,光生电子和空穴容易复合,导致光催化性能不理想。本研究采用S/P共掺杂和二次煅烧改性相结合的方法成功制备了具有优良光降解性能的g-C3 N4纳米片。由于双元素掺杂和二次焙烧的协同作用,改性g-C3 N4在4 min内对罗丹明B(30 mg L−1)的降解率达到99.4%,是纯g-C3 N4的15倍。此外,利用光催化分解水制氢的实验结果与光催化分解水制氢的实验结果不同,表明其关键因素与光降解反应不同,为g-C3 N4的改性提供了一种有效可行的新思路。
The metal-free and low-cost g-C3N4has received a lot of attention from researchers as a photocatalyst to solve environmental and energy problems. However, bulk g-C3N4suffers from limited light absorption, few reactive sites and easy recombination of photogenerated electrons and holes, resulting in unsatisfactory photocatalytic performance. In this study, g-C3N4nanosheets with excellent photodegradation performance were successfully fabricated by a combination of S/P co-doping and secondary calcination modifications. The modified g-C3N4could degrade 99.4% rhodamine B (30 mg L−1) in only 4 min, which was 15 times higher than that of pure g-C3N4due to the synergistic effect of bi-element doping and secondary calcination. Furthermore, experiments using photocatalytic water splitting for hydrogen production have shown different results, demonstrating that the critical factor is different from the photodegradation reaction.This paper provides an effective and feasible novel idea for the modification of g-C3N4.
